I own a 06 Jetta TDI (6 speed auto) and drove it across Canada on the highway this summer. I went from London Ontario to Victoria B.C. Its a 55 litre tank and with the empty light on and 30 more KMs driven before we fueled we were at 1019 KMs driven on 52-55 litres of Diesel.

we have found with our TDis that you are good for another 100kms when the low fuel light comes on. I typcially find it's about 100 kms for every eighth of a tank and then plus whatever you can jam in above that (ventectomy / clicking the button)
